StanCraft Jet Center Secures DLA Fueling Contract for Military and Wildfire Aircraft
StanCraft Jet Center has been awarded a fueling contract by the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) to provide fuel services for U.S. military and Department of Defense aircraft. The company will also support wildfire response aircraft in the Pacific Northwest, ensuring rapid fueling during peak fire season. StanCraft Jet Center, in partnership with World Fuel Services, will uphold federal quality control standards and safety compliance for military aircraft fueling.
